技术文摘
Navicat如何修改编码
Navicat如何修改编码
在使用Navicat进行数据库管理时,修改编码是一个常见需求。正确设置编码可以确保数据的准确显示与处理,避免出现乱码等问题。那么,Navicat究竟该如何修改编码呢?
打开Navicat软件,找到你需要操作的数据库连接。右键点击该连接,选择“属性”选项。在弹出的属性窗口中,切换到“连接”选项卡。在这里,我们可以看到一些基本的连接设置,编码选项就在其中。
如果是针对MySQL数据库,一般默认的编码是UTF - 8。若要修改编码,点击编码选项的下拉框,里面会列出多种编码格式供你选择,比如GBK、GB2312等。选择你所需要的编码后,点击“确定”保存设置。不过需要注意的是,不同的编码支持的字符集不同,要根据实际需求合理选择。
对于Oracle数据库连接,在属性窗口中找到“高级”选项卡。在这里,有一个“字符集”的设置项。点击它旁边的下拉按钮,同样可以选择不同的编码。当选择好编码后,点击“确定”完成修改。
若要修改已存在数据库表的编码,情况会稍微复杂一些。以MySQL为例,先备份好数据库中的数据。接着使用SQL语句来进行修改。可以使用“ALTER DATABASE 数据库名 CHARACTER SET = 新编码名;”语句修改整个数据库的编码。对于特定的表,则使用“ALTER TABLE 表名 CONVERT TO CHARACTER SET 新编码名;”语句。
在修改编码时,一定要谨慎操作。因为编码修改不当可能导致数据丢失或显示异常。如果在修改编码后出现问题,应及时将编码改回原来的设置,并检查数据的完整性。
掌握Navicat修改编码的方法,对于数据库管理员和开发者来说至关重要。它不仅能够保障数据的正常存储与读取,还能提高工作效率,确保项目的顺利进行。无论是初次接触还是经验丰富的专业人士,都需要熟练掌握这一技能,以便更好地应对各种数据库管理任务。
- 十个 Java 高手必知的 IntelliJ IDEA 插件
- 2025 年助力 Web 开发人员崭露头角的五项技术趋势
- Java 中逃逸分析的应用及优化
- 工作中 MQ 的巧妙运用,益处多多
- 从零构建高性能 LLM 推理引擎:简单黑盒算法 AI 系统与电子墨水屏时间表及专用小型语言模型
- 七项 CSS 新功能你竟不知
- Python `__slots__` 进阶探秘:超越内存节省,原理与实践全解
- 三分钟掌握 C++20 Lambda 模版参数
- 深入剖析 synchronized 原理 性能竟如此出色
- Python 列表推导式进阶:lambda 与 map 函数的融合
- 利用 Option 模式与对接层优化管理 Go 项目外部 API
- UML 用例图绘制:Claude 10 秒完成,逼真程度超乎想象!
- C++ 虚函数的实现原理原来是这样
- 你是否正确使用了 @NotNull、@NotBlank 和 @NotEmpty?
- 解决 Python 脚本运行速度慢的十种方法